Antres moon images

Hi
As well as videoing the dissapearance of Antres I got images beforehand. One is deliberately overexposed, to show the dark limb of the moon, other is normally exposed and is a stack of 5 images showing multiple images of Antares as the moon moved closer to it.
Taken with 450D camera, 10 inch f5.6 newtonian and MPCC coma corrector
